## Service Account: metrics-sidecar

The sidecar (project Tallyhawk) runs alongside each app pod and aggregates metrics before forwarding them to the central Countinghouse collector. Support team: if dashboards go stale, restart the sidecar first, then verify its credential hasn't been revoked. The account is read-local, write-collector only. The credential it authenticates with is listed below.

app token of kafop-hahaf = kto11_iRLdsMBafGn

Ticket: Config drift on thumbnail generation queue (Pellwick cluster)

During the quarterly review we found the thumbnail queue workers in the Pellwick cluster running settings that diverge from the committed baseline. The drift appears to predate the last audited deploy, so please treat the live values as unverified. For comparison, the values currently observed on the running instances are:

deployment values, yafop-tahof:
HOLIX_HOST=holix.zemvarsys.internal
HOLIX_PORT=3306

## Runbook: Prosewright linter for plugin authors

If your plugin fails the Prosewright docs lint, run it locally first with the same ruleset the Hollybrook CI uses. Fetch the shared ruleset bundle via the plugin CLI, which requires authenticating to the Prosewright registry. Create an env file in your plugin root; the registry auth token must be set on the line immediately following this sentence.

sealed setting: VAULT_KEY20=c8ea1e419912889df6b4